England's rugby league team is gearing up for the 2026 World Cup, and coach Brian McDermott has made a notable decision by recalling Jake Connor, the reigning Man of Steel.
Alongside Connor, the squad features 10 uncapped players, indicating a blend of experience and fresh talent as the team prepares for the upcoming tournament.
The performance squad consists of 38 players, reflecting McDermott's strategy to evaluate a wide range of talent ahead of the World Cup.
